How to Cancel CoinSnap: Coin Identifier and Get a Refund
CoinSnap: Coin Identifier subscriptions are billed through Apple or Google, not inside the app, so you cancel them in your store settings. Below are the steps for both iPhone and Android, how to request a refund, and what users report about CoinSnap: Coin Identifier billing.
Cancel CoinSnap: Coin Identifier on iPhone (iOS)
- 1Open the Settings app on your iPhone or iPad.
- 2Tap your name at the top of the screen to open your Apple ID.
- 3Tap Subscriptions to see every app that bills you through Apple.
- 4Find CoinSnap: Coin Identifier in the list and tap it. If it is not there, you may have subscribed through the app itself or a different Apple ID.
- 5Tap Cancel Subscription and confirm. You keep access to CoinSnap: Coin Identifier until the current billing period ends, then it will not renew.
Cancel CoinSnap: Coin Identifier on Android
- 1Open the Google Play Store app on your Android device.
- 2Tap your profile icon, then Payments & subscriptions, then Subscriptions.
- 3Select CoinSnap: Coin Identifier from your list of subscriptions.
- 4Tap Cancel subscription and choose a reason when prompted.
- 5Confirm the cancellation. Uninstalling CoinSnap: Coin Identifier on its own does not stop billing, you must cancel the subscription here.
How to get a refund for CoinSnap: Coin Identifier
Canceling stops future renewals but does not refund a charge you already paid. Request the refund from the store separately.
Go to reportaproblem.apple.com, sign in with your Apple ID, find the CoinSnap: Coin Identifier charge, choose Request a refund, pick a reason and submit.
Open the Play Store, go to your order history, select the CoinSnap: Coin Identifier purchase, tap Report a problem and request a refund. Requests within 48 hours are often auto-approved.

Why is CoinSnap: Coin Identifier still charging me after I canceled?
The most common causes: the cancellation did not finish (check that Subscriptions shows CoinSnap: Coin Identifier as Expired), you have a second subscription under a different Apple ID or Google account, or you canceled inside the app but not in the store where billing actually lives. Cancel it in the App Store subscription settings to be sure.
